Ordered 110 of food knowing our family was out sick for a week and we found that 1. Portions were amazing - probably 12-14 meals! 2. Food was great! There was not one thing we didn’t like. We had two mofongos with pork, bacalaitos, two rice specials, two empanadas, burnt rice ends (free and delicious if you ask), tostones, two pasteles en hoja, one chimi sandwich with smoked sausage. If we had to choose, our favorites were the mofongo with pork. Whatever they season that pork with is incredible. The empanadas were so good - the crust had a great crunch, bread was seasoned perfectly, and the meat was both dry enough to not leak through, but juicy enough to just melt in your mouth. The rice specials were also outstanding - each time we had to half it because it was so filling, but the meat was cooked perfectly and the rice and beans were delicious. Special shout-out to the chimi sandwich which was seasoned really well and the smoked sausage was had a great flavor. We can’t wait to try out the rest of the menu!
